1987 Avanti Avanti vs. 1996 Kia Avella

To start off, 1996 Kia Avella is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1987 Avanti Avanti.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1987 Avanti Avanti would be higher. At 5,002 cc (8 cylinders), 1987 Avanti Avanti is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1987 Avanti Avanti (202 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 130 more horse power than 1996 Kia Avella. (72 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1987 Avanti Avanti should accelerate faster than 1996 Kia Avella.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1987 Avanti Avanti weights approximately 785 kg more than 1996 Kia Avella.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1987 Avanti Avanti (325 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 190 more torque (in Nm) than 1996 Kia Avella. (135 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1987 Avanti Avanti will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1996 Kia Avella.
